What is the difference between Engineer Product Engineer vs Mechanical Engineer?

AspectEngineer Product EngineerMechanical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Engineering, often in Mechanical, Electrical, or Industrial EngineeringBachelor's or higher in Mechanical Engineering or related field
Work EnvironmentProduct development teams, R&D, manufacturingDesign, analysis, testing, manufacturing environments
Industry UsageTechnology, consumer products, automotive, aerospaceManufacturing, automotive, aerospace, energy
Common Search/ComparisonEngineer Product Engineer vs Mechanical Engineer

Engineer Product Engineers focus on developing and improving products, working closely with design and manufacturing teams. Mechanical Engineers typically focus on designing, analyzing, and testing mechanical systems and components. While both roles require engineering degrees and share some skills, their primary responsibilities and work environments differ, with Product Engineers emphasizing product lifecycle management and Mechanical Engineers concentrating on mechanical system design and analysis.

What does a product engineer do?

A product engineer designs, develops, and tests products to ensure they meet quality, safety, and performance standards. They collaborate with cross-functional teams, use engineering tools and software, and often work through the product lifecycle from concept to production.

Your Responsibilities

AsProduct Engineer for JD Coffeyville Works located in Coffeyville, KS, you will:

  • Design drivetrain components within transmission and gearboxes such as gears, shafts, castings and other components to meet performance, cost, and schedule requirements
  • Perform engineering calculations to solve design problems and develop design alternatives
  • Manage design from concept to prototype and through to full production through collaboration with other functional groups
  • Provide technical support to marketing, manufacturing, quality and supply management organizations
  • Develop and execute test and analysis plans for product verification and validation
  • Develop well rounded engineering skills by doing at least one development rotation in a factory engineering roll

VISA Sponsorship is NOT available for this position

What Skills You Need
  • Mechanical design and analysis skills
  • Experience with engineering tools, systems and databases
What Makes You Stand Out
  • Technical experience relating to design/diagnostics of mechanical/electrical/hydraulic systems
  • Experience with engineering tools, systems and databases
  • Familiarity with MS Office products, Creo, SAP
  • Clear and concise verbal and written communication skills
Education

Ideally you will have a degree or equivalent related work experience in the following:

  • BS in Mechanical Engineering or equivalent
